WASHINGTON - Alone at dinner, Robert Gates was approached the other night by a stranger whose pleading words brought home the meaning of becoming the next defense secretary in charge of two wars.
"She said, 'I have two sons in Iraq. For God's sake, bring them home safe. And we'll be praying for you.'See the full content of this document
